Senior Accountant Overview: 

OWNZONES Entertainment Technologies (OET) is looking for a talented Senior Accountant to join the growing team remote during COVID and then in our Beverly Hills office. This is an exciting role for those who are interested in the future of media and entertainment. Working at OET means having the opportunity to impact key strategic areas and get involved at the ground level with a fast-paced startup in the consumer and enterprise digital media space.  This position is remote but upon returning to offices it may be based in Los Angeles in our Beverly Hills office.

Primary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Own and manage day-to-day accounting operations including cash management, the posting and maintenance of general ledger accounts, accounts payable, accounts receivable, payroll transactions, bank and credit card reconciliations and journal entries.
  • Ensure daily and monthly processes and reconciliations are completed and lead to timely and accurate month-end closes.
  • Manage month-end closing activities and consolidation for two European subsidiaries.
  • Prepare financial reports and statements.
  • Review, document and implement financial terms of contractual agreements with vendors and customers
  • Assist with the development, documentation and enforcement of internal controls, policies and procedures.
  • Work with 3rd party tax accountant to assure timely filing of tax returns 
  • Support payroll, HR, M&A, budgeting and financial planning activities. 
  • Partner with business owners, customers and vendors.
  • Ad hoc projects as needed.

About OWNZONES Entertainment Technologies 

OWNZONES began in 2010 as a content company focused on breaking the industry conventions of bundled linear content (much like today's Amazon channels). After creating, launching and operating over 400 digital channels, managing over 5 million assets, and distributing to over 25 countries, we realized our key to success was in the technologies we built and now offer as a solution. These products have made us the leader in cloud-based video supply chain solutions. Our transformative platform is built by a team of experts with decades of combined experience at companies such as Amazon, HBO, Netflix and Microsoft.

Our client, a high growth healthcare technology company is seeking a Vice President of Finance.  

The person in this role will work closely with the executive team and report to the Head of Business Operations. This is an exciting opportunity for a talented finance leader to build the finance function. Ideal candidates will be excited about working in a fast-moving entrepreneurial startup environment and have extensive experience in corporate finance with a high-growth SaaS organization.

 Responsibilities

  • Financial strategy and infrastructure:
    • Create systems, frameworks and processes that enhance financial rigor.
    • Assess current set of financial tools and implement future systems for financial reporting analysis, forecasting, and accounting
    • Ensure accurate subscription billing and monthly reconciliations of AR for completeness and accuracy
    • Build and develop the finance team into an organization focused on performance
  • Corporate planning and analysis: 
    • Drive the annual budgeting and forecasting process.
    • Develop and own the cadence for monthly, quarterly, and annual financial close and reporting of results to leadership and key stakeholders, including the board and investors
    • Partner with senior leaders to ensure the company hits its revenue targets and achieves goals within budget
    • Own all aspects of financial planning (e.g., cash flow requirements, the balance sheet, and income statement).
    • Provide modeling and analytical support for strategic projects, new product development and go-to-market strategy.
  • Influence change: Bring strong business and operational orientation to influence business decisions and strategy

Requirements

  • 7+ years of experience in a finance leadership role with an excellent understanding of business metrics and processes in a high-growth SaaS environment.
  • Experience scaling a company over $100M in ARR
  • Comfortable in the player-coach mode as you build your team
  • Expertise in FP&A, including financial modeling, business scenario planning, managing risk and cost
  • Experience overseeing client billing, collections, accounts receivable and payables
  • Undergraduate degree in Finance or Accounting, with strong foundational accounting principles
  • Experience with post C round fundraising
  • Thrive in a fast-changing environment and ambiguity, while being execution-oriented, hands-on, pragmatic, and focused on results
